Sandia Heights has a major risk of flooding. 391 properties in Sandia Heights are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 27% of all properties in Sandia Heights.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

Sandia Heights has a major risk of wildfire. There are 2,043 properties in Sandia Heights that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 100% of all properties in Sandia Heights.
